About the role

At the Director level, Private Client Services should be about more than overseeing compliance. You should have a meaningful voice in the relationships, planning, and growth of the practice.

A leading public accounting and advisory firm is looking to add a Private Client Services Tax Director to work with high-net-worth and ultra-high-net-worth individuals, families, business owners, trusts, and estates.

This role is designed for an experienced private client professional who can own sophisticated relationships, lead complex planning, develop teams, and become increasingly involved in growing the practice.

You'll advise clients whose financial lives often span closely held businesses, investment partnerships, trusts, estates, real estate, and multigenerational wealth - giving you the opportunity to work across the entire client relationship rather than one piece of it.

Compensation: $190,000–$250,000 base salary + bonus/incentive compensation, depending on experience, market, client relationships, and business development experience.

Responsibilities

Own and lead significant high-net-worth and ultra-high-net-worth individual and family relationships

Advise clients on complex individual, fiduciary, estate, gift, and closely held business tax matters

Lead year-round planning around income taxes, wealth transfer, gifting strategies, trusts, investments, and family business interests

Oversee complex individual, trust, estate, gift, partnership, and related compliance engagements

Coordinate planning across multiple entities and generations within sophisticated family structures

Work directly with attorneys, wealth advisors, investment professionals, bankers, and other outside advisors

Translate complex tax matters into practical strategies for clients and their families

Serve as a senior technical resource for Managers, Seniors, and other members of the PCS practice

Lead and develop engagement teams while maintaining accountability for quality, service, and profitability

Manage engagement economics, pricing, scope, staffing, realization, and overall client delivery

Identify opportunities to deepen existing relationships through additional planning, tax, and advisory services

Develop new relationships through referrals, centers of influence, and broader business development activity

Participate in recruiting, talent development, and strategic initiatives across the Private Client Services practice

Work directly with Partners on the continued growth and direction of the practice

Build toward Partner-level responsibility through client leadership, revenue growth, and business development

Qualifications

10+ years of progressive public accounting tax experience

Current Tax Director, Senior Tax Manager, Principal, or equivalent private client leadership experience

CPA required; MST, JD, or LLM is a plus

Significant experience serving high-net-worth and ultra-high-net-worth individuals and families

Deep technical experience across individual, fiduciary, estate, and gift taxation

Strong understanding of partnerships, closely held businesses, investment structures, and other entities commonly held by private clients

Significant tax planning and advisory experience beyond annual compliance

Proven ability to independently own sophisticated client relationships

Experience coordinating with attorneys, wealth advisors, investment professionals, and other outside advisors

Demonstrated ability to identify and develop additional opportunities within existing relationships

Experience mentoring Managers and developing high-performing teams

Strong executive presence and ability to communicate complex planning strategies to sophisticated clients

Business development experience and established referral relationships are highly valued
